This webinar explores how HR and absence leaders can move from reactive, manual leave administration to proactive, compliant, and employee-centric programs. Drawing on insights from Pulpstream’s 2026 State of Leave Management benchmark report and a real-world case study from a large, multi-state employer managing nearly 30,000 employees, this session highlights how AI-powered automation is reshaping absence management. Attendees will learn how intelligent workflows will bring new efficiencies to absence management. The webinar will also address emerging compliance complexity, multi-state challenges, and why organizations that invest in AI-driven leave platforms are better positioned to scale, stay compliant, and support employees during critical life moments.

Learning Objectives
- Identify key trends shaping the future of absence management, including rising multi-state compliance complexity, increasing employee expectations, and the operational risks associated with manual leave administration.
- Evaluate the operational and compliance gaps in traditional leave processes and assess how AI-powered automation and intelligent workflows can reduce processing time, improve audit readiness, and minimize regulatory risk
- Analyze a real-world case study of a large, multi-state employer to understand how implementing an AI-driven leave platform improved efficiency, scalability, and proactive employee support.
- Develop practical strategies to transition from reactive leave management to a proactive, employee-centric absence program, leveraging technology to enhance compliance, workforce experience, and long-term organizational resilience.
